- [ ] **Step 7: Breaker override escrow.** After sealing the signing keys for the Tallgrove upstream API circuit breaker, confirm the support team can force the breaker open during a full outage. The override bundle lives in the sealed escrow drawer and is useless without its unlock phrase. Two ceremony witnesses must initial this step before proceeding. The escrow bundle is decrypted with the recovery passphrase that follows.

vault phrase of kahip-kahop = holath-quenmir

Subject: Floor 7 now open — night shift access

Night team,

Floor 7 of the Pellgrove Building opens Monday. Patrol rounds now include it: check both stairwell doors and the new kitchenette. Lifts serve the floor after hours, but the landing door stays locked until permanent badge profiles update next week. In the meantime, enter using the interim keypad code below.

door code, tagef-bajop: bdg-SB-7

## Further Reading

Clueforge internals are split across three docs: grid-fill algorithm notes, the clue database schema, and the puzzle export format. Read the fill notes first; the backtracker's pruning heuristics are non-obvious and easy to break. Word-list licensing constraints are covered in the schema doc. All three, plus benchmark history and open design questions, are collected on the internal page here.

wiki page, bawef-hafop: https://jira.nelvroworks.corp/job/pages/projects/7c5c0f440dbd

**Deploy step 7 — canary gating**

Support folks, here's the short version: Bramblewire canaries only promote when error rate stays under 0.5% and latency p95 holds for 20 minutes. If a customer reports weirdness mid-rollout, check whether the gate paused the canary before escalating — half the time it already rolled back on its own. To peek at gate status yourself, point the CLI at the gating API with `GATE_ENV=production`, and note that the env file carries the gate API's access secret on the line immediately after that.

vault entry, yahif-yajep: COURIER_KEY29=b802bdf8034096b65a51c6ba5abe2